Code P2122 2011 Nissan Sentra Description
Accelerator pedal position sensor has two sensors. These sensors are a kind of potentiometers which transform the accelerator pedal position into output voltage, and emit the voltage signal to the ECM.
In addition, these sensors detect the opening and closing speed of the accelerator pedal and feed the voltage signals to the ECM. The ECM judges the current opening angle of the accelerator pedal from these signals and controls the throttle control motor based on these signals.
Idle position of the accelerator pedal is determined by the ECM receiving the signal from the accelerator pedal position sensor. The ECM uses this signal for the engine operation
such as fuel cut.
What are the Possible Causes of the DTC P2122 2011 Nissan Sentra?
- Faulty Accelerator Pedal Position Sensor
- Accelerator Pedal Position Sensor harness is open or shorted
- Accelerator Pedal Position Sensor circuit poor electrical connection
How to Fix the DTC P2122 2011 Nissan Sentra?
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.
What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?
Labor: 1.0
To diagnose the P2122 2011 Nissan Sentra code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80β$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.

Frequently Asked Questions about P2122 2011 Nissan Sentra Code
1. What does the OBDII code P2122 for a 2011 Nissan Sentra mean?
The code P2122 indicates a problem with the Accelerator Pedal Position Sensor Circuit Range/Performance in the vehicle.
2. What are the common symptoms of OBDII code P2122 in a 2011 Nissan Sentra?
Common symptoms of code P2122 may include issues with acceleration, reduced engine power, stalling, and possibly the vehicle going into limp mode.
3. What are the possible causes of OBDII code P2122 in a 2011 Nissan Sentra?
Potential causes of code P2122 can include a faulty accelerator pedal position sensor, damaged wiring or connectors in the sensor circuit, or issues with the engine control module.
4. How can I diagnose the OBDII code P2122 in my 2011 Nissan Sentra?
Diagnosing code P2122 usually involves using a scan tool to read the code and then performing tests on the accelerator pedal position sensor, checking the wiring and connectors for damage, and verifying the signal to the engine control module.
5. Can I continue driving my 2011 Nissan Sentra with the OBDII code P2122?
It is not recommended to continue driving with code P2122 present, as it can affect the vehicle's performance and potentially lead to further damage. It's best to address the issue promptly.
6. How can I repair OBDII code P2122 in my 2011 Nissan Sentra?
Repairing code P2122 may involve replacing the accelerator pedal position sensor, repairing or replacing damaged wiring or connectors, or reprogramming the engine control module.
7. Will resetting the OBDII code P2122 in my 2011 Nissan Sentra make it go away permanently?
Simply resetting the code may temporarily turn off the check engine light, but if the underlying issue causing code P2122 is not addressed, the code is likely to reappear.
